What Guests Are Saying
Fidler's Bend Outdoors is praised for its friendly staff, spacious campsites, and a diverse range of trails suitable for various skill levels. Many visitors appreciated the well-maintained main areas and the option for onsite float trips. However, some concerns were raised about the unpleasant smell of the water and the lack of trail markings, which could affect safety and navigation. Overall, guests expressed a desire to return despite a few challenges during their visits.

Super nice staff and main areas are well maintained. Loads of parking, enough for large vehicles and large trailers. However, the trails are not marked at all as far as I saw. They have a map at the front but not very detailed. It is very easy to be on a trail and end up at a double black diamond hill climb. The only way around is turning around. This place has great potential, but to compete with flagship style off-road parks, they’re going to have to mark these trails to keep a steady flow of vehicles and prevent accidents. For the money that is spent for entrance(each person, driver or passenger), the marking of the trails needs to be done.
